Transaction 58f79ee194db1cbda73c9a850995a667b8dc84f4f8e673fefca45e528cfd0f3e

1 Input
2 Outputs
  • 58f79ee194db1cbda73c9a850995a667b8dc84f4f8e673fefca45e528cfd0f3e:0
  • value  1620330
    address  34zozXKRu8PzF8zUb4UDSnPuHA8RaAhpHy
  • 58f79ee194db1cbda73c9a850995a667b8dc84f4f8e673fefca45e528cfd0f3e:1
  • value  27591765
    address  31n7Q4JQLL8xHmsna2yy1AS3JPe3KKpkTd